Lahore: The Counter-Terrorism Department (CTD) Sunday gunned down three alleged militants during a raid on their hideout in Lahore's Ferozewala area.


Pakistani counterterrorism police said they killed three militants in a face on face gun-battle early Sunday.
The CTD spokesperson said, “The militants were staying at a rented house in Ferozewala where they were planning attacks on intelligence agencies and other law enforcement personnel”.
The suspects also planned to target important persons, added the CTD.
The spokesperson further revealed particulars of operation saying, “All three terrorists hailed from Afghanistan, said the CTD and officers conducted the operation on the basis of intelligence”.
However, tipped by intelligence, the CTD performed the raid on their residence, after seeing the CTD personnel, the militants opened fire.
He stated that retaliatory hearth from the CTD killed three militants.
The cops recovered suicide vest, three hand grenades and two Kalashnikov rifles from their possession.
